Compare all specifications:
1964 Austin-Healey 3000 Mk III | 1998 Mercedes-Benz SL | |
Make | Austin-Healey | Mercedes-Benz |
Model | 3000 Mk III | SL |
Year Released | 1964 | 1998 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 2912 cc | 4966 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 8 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| V |
Valves per Cylinder | 2 valves | 3 valves |
Horse Power | 148 HP | 302 HP |
Engine RPM | 5250 RPM | 5600 RPM |
Torque | 225 Nm | 461 Nm |
Torque RPM | 3500 RPM | 2700 RPM |
Engine Bore Size | 83.4 mm | 97 mm |
Engine Stroke Size | 88.9 mm | 84 mm |
Top Speed | 195 km/hour | 250 km/hour |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Automatic |
Number of Seats | 4 seats | 2 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 2 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1180 kg | 1890 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4010 mm | 4510 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1540 mm | 1820 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1240 mm | 1300 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2340 mm | 2520 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 54 L | 80 L |
